School's Out Teen Space at the Ballard Branch -- catch up with your friends! We'll have snacks and share ideas about good things to read this summer. Submit your summer reading reviews for a chance to win an e-reader! Description:
Teen Space at the Ballard Branch is a place to meet up and hang out! Why not get out of the house for a while and head to the library? Come alone or bring your friends -- then make new friends!
We’ll also have music, board games and art supplies. Teen Space = a free way to be creative and have fun.
The Seattle Public Library celebrates the 50th anniversary of the 1962 World’s Fair with your Summer Reading Program.
To participate:
- Sign up online at www.spl.org/teensrp or at your branch by entering your name in the notebook binder.
- Join our scavenger hunt! Visit www.spl.org/bookcrossing to participate in Century 22, our teen book scavenger hunt, where you can find, track and release books!
- Read and review 3 books to enter a drawing for a free Kindle e-reader!
- Create your summer reading shelf, a personal avatar and earn badges online.
Enjoy free programs at the Library all summer long!
